Playing Time / Development Topic

It’s been a few years ago, but I got wind somewhere along the way that position player development in the minors was more about games played than it was innings or plate appearances. That seems to be accurate to me.

Someone else suggested that pitcher development was similar, so perhaps better to stick good SP prospects into the bullpen. They appear in more games, but pitch fewer innings, and in the process are less likely to get hurt. Made sense.

And yet I’m not totally sure I’ve developed a pitcher very well since beginning that strategy - but I also haven’t had many really great prospects to judge the strategy against.

I'd hazard a guess that pitchers only need 1/5th the game appearances as position players to get the same level of development credit, otherwise SP would never fully develop. That said, I tend to (or used to until I got lazier) put all my pitching studs in Setup roles to get max appearances just in case. I also try to set low pitch counts (5-10) so they recover to 100% quicker and get more appearances but also so they throw fewer pitches over the course of the season and therefore less likely to get injured. 10 pitches/game over 81 games (if they can even get in that many) as a SuA is roughly 1/3-1/4 the amount of pitches they'd throw as a starter. I've had too many great prospects become good, or good prospects become meh, to let them play the typical amount of starter innings in the minors.

I've been using the Tandem role in the minors for the past few seasons, with pretty good results. I'll have a 6-man rotation with 3 tandem. That way, they're starting every 3 days. The day after they're start, I'll move them to a Set A role, reduce the pitch count to 10. Most of the time, they'll get in another 2/3 to 1 1/3 inning in relief and be fresh for the next tandem start. It's a lot of load management, but appearances are way up.
